git自动转到默认分支
-
要让git自动转到默认分支,需要进行以下几个步骤:
第一步,查看当前git的默认分支是哪个。在终端中运行以下命令:
“`bash
git remote show origin
“`输出结果中会显示当前的默认分支,比如`HEAD branch: develop`,表示默认分支是`develop`。
第二步,确认本地是否已经存在默认分支。在终端中运行以下命令:
“`bash
git branch –list
“`会列出所有本地分支,其中默认分支会带有`*`号标记,比如`* develop`。
如果本地已经存在默认分支,则无需进行下一步。
第三步,创建一个新的分支,并将其设为默认分支。在终端中运行以下命令:
“`bash
git checkout -b develop origin/develop
git branch –set-upstream-to=origin/develop develop
“`上述命令中的`develop`表示新创建的分支名称,可以根据需要进行修改。
第四步,将新的默认分支推送到远程仓库。在终端中运行以下命令:
“`bash
git push origin develop
“`以上就是让git自动转到默认分支的步骤。通过创建新的分支并将其设为默认分支,然后将其推送到远程仓库,就可以实现git自动转到默认分支的功能。
2年前 -
标题:Git如何设置默认分支并自动切换
Git是一个非常流行的分布式版本控制系统,它允许开发者在团队合作中管理代码的变更。当使用Git时,默认分支是一个重要的概念,它是开发者在没有指定分支的情况下操作的主分支。为了在工作中更加方便,可以设置默认分支,使得每次执行git命令时,默认都切换到指定的分支。下面是关于如何设置默认分支并自动切换的一些方法:
1. 查看当前分支
在终端或命令行中,使用以下命令可以查看当前所在的分支:
“`
git branch –show-current
“`2. 设置默认分支
设置默认分支可以通过修改Git的配置文件完成。在终端或命令行中,使用以下命令打开全局配置文件:
“`
git config –global –edit
“`
在配置文件中,找到`[init]`部分,新增或修改`defaultBranch`项,设置为想要的默认分支名称,例如:
“`
[init]
defaultBranch = main
“`3. 自动切换到默认分支
在Git 2.28版本以后,可以通过设置`init.defaultBranch`属性实现自动切换到默认分支。在终端或命令行中,使用以下命令设置:
“`
git config –global init.defaultBranch main
“`4. 切换到默认分支
如果已经设置了默认分支,但当前仓库还没有切换到默认分支,可以使用以下命令手动切换:
“`
git checkout main
“`5. 更新远程仓库的默认分支
如果要将本地仓库的默认分支更新到远程仓库,需要先切换到想要设置为新默认分支的分支,然后使用以下命令推送到远程仓库:
“`
git push -u origin main
“`
在此之后,远程仓库的默认分支将被更新为`main`。以上是关于如何设置默认分支并自动切换的一些方法。通过设置默认分支,可以减少在切换分支时输入命令的次数,提高工作效率。但在设置之前,请确保已经了解所在团队或项目的默认分支的规范,以避免造成代码的混乱或冲突。
2年前 -
在Git中,可以通过设置来实现自动切换到默认分支。默认分支通常是被称为”master”的分支,但是在不同的项目中可能会有不同的命名。
下面是设置自动切换到默认分支的步骤:
步骤1:查看当前Git版本
首先,需要检查你的Git版本是否已经升级到2.28或更高版本。可以通过输入以下命令来检查Git的版本:“`
git –version
“`如果输出的版本号小于2.28,则需要更新你的Git版本。
步骤2:配置默认分支名称
要设置自动切换到默认分支,需要使用以下命令来配置默认分支的名称:“`
git config –global init.defaultBranch
“`其中,`
`是你项目中的默认分支的名称。例如,如果你的默认分支被命名为”main”,则可以执行以下命令: “`
git config –global init.defaultBranch main
“`这样,Git就会将你指定的分支设置为默认分支。
步骤3:创建新项目时自动切换到默认分支
一旦你在全局配置中设置了默认分支名称,Git就会自动将工作目录切换到默认分支。这意味着,当你创建一个新的Git仓库时,工作目录将自动切换到默认分支。要创建一个新的Git仓库并自动切换到默认分支,可以执行以下命令:
“`
git initcd “` 这样,你就创建了一个新的Git仓库,并且工作目录已经自动切换到默认分支。
总结:通过以上步骤,你可以设置Git自动切换到默认分支。请确保Git版本升级到2.28或更高版本,并使用`git config`命令设置默认分支名称。随后,在创建新的Git仓库时,工作目录将自动切换到默认分支。
2年前